What is a Mastercam programmer?

A Mastercam programmer is a professional who uses Mastercam software to create and optimize toolpaths for CNC (Computer Numerical Control) machines. Their main responsibility is to translate engineering designs into precise instructions that CNC machines can follow to manufacture parts. Mastercam programmers work closely with engineers and machinists to ensure products are made accurately and efficiently, often programming for milling, turning, and other machining operations. Their expertise helps improve production speed, reduce waste, and maintain high-quality standards in manufacturing.

What are the key skills and qualifications needed to thrive as a Mastercam programmer?

To thrive as a Mastercam Programmer, you need strong CAD/CAM knowledge, experience in CNC machining, and typically a background in manufacturing technology or engineering. Proficiency with Mastercam software, G-code programming, and familiarity with CNC milling and turning machines are essential. Attention to detail, problem-solving ability, and effective communication help ensure accurate part production and collaboration with machinists and engineers. These skills ensure efficient, high-quality manufacturing processes and help meet production goals with minimal errors.

What are some common challenges faced by Mastercam programmers and how can they be addressed?

Mastercam programmers often encounter challenges such as optimizing toolpaths for efficiency, minimizing machine downtime, and ensuring part accuracy. Staying up to date with software updates and best practices is crucial, as is clear communication with machinists and engineers to interpret design intent correctly. Collaborating closely with the production team and regularly reviewing post-processing settings can help address common issues and improve workflow. Many companies support ongoing training and knowledge sharing to help programmers stay current and solve problems effectively.

SUMMARY:

VadaTech, Inc. is a world leader in the design and manufacturing of embedded computing solutions. Due to continued growth, we are seeking candidates for the CNC Programmer position. The CNC Programmer will be responsible for designing programs, determining processes, tools, programming (in Master CAM), and setting up. In addition to troubleshooting, improving existing programs, setting up, and operating multi-axis (true 5-axis, 3+2) and CNC (Vertical/Turning) equipment.

RESPONSIBILITIES:

REASONABLE ACCOMMODATIONS MAY BE MADE TO ENABLE INDIVIDUALS WITH DISABILITIES TO PERFORM THE ESSENTIAL FUNCTIONS.

  • Use engineering drawings to program CNC part programs, designed parts and assemblies.
  • Proficient in reading and interpreting 3D & 2D engineering models.
  • Interface directly with Manufacturing Engineering regarding the tooling requirements of individual machined projects.
  • Use measuring gauges, including micrometers, calipers, height gauge, depth gauge, and bore gauges. 
  • Perform daily cleaning and light maintenance tasks on machinery.
  • Ensure all manufacturing safety & regulatory policies and procedures are implemented and maintained at all times. 
  • Actively practice a culture of 5S (sort, set, order, shine, standardize, and sustain) in the machine shop.
  • Set up, operate, and monitor CNC machines according to specifications and quality standards.
  • Load, edit, and update CNC programs as required to support production needs and engineering changes.
  • Perform machine adjustments and tool offsets to ensure accurate machining operations.
  • Inspect finished parts using measuring instruments to verify conformance to drawings and specifications.
  • Maintain production records and document program revisions.
  • Follow all safety procedures and maintain a clean, organized work area.
  • Upload and retrieve data; as well as other interactions within the Machine Shop ERP system.

QUALIFICATIONS AND EDUCATION REQUIREMENTS:

  • Experience in multi-axis (5-axis) CNC Machining.
  • Experience in live tooling CNC Turning.
  • Knowledge of machining techniques and methods.
  • Ability to read and interpret engineering drawings. 
  • Additional experience with welding, grinding, and waterjet is a plus.
  • Experience with ProShop ERP is a plus.
  • Solid working knowledge of Mastercam required. 
  • Knowledge and understanding of lean manufacturing and its application to the machine shop environment. 
  • Experience with using standard inspection tools and methods in the evaluation of machined parts. 
  • Ability to work in both R&D and production rate environments.
